Output 764fd63d61250d2ea22c91b3c7d81c8720e9a2d71febafa5e84c5d4e7371a5cc:5

value
2324349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ac95ee2fdae563311881f7fd5bdf5be28d36b7 OP_EQUAL
address
3B3ubaAvqSsZ9z3wRPk42KeZB2GoCCwVQK
transaction
764fd63d61250d2ea22c91b3c7d81c8720e9a2d71febafa5e84c5d4e7371a5cc
spent
true